Alaska Airlines (ALK) has announced a strategic investment in Loft Dynamics, aiming to develop the first hyper-realistic, full-motion Boeing 737 VR simulator. The investment, made through Alaska Star Ventures, will support the creation of virtual reality training technology that could revolutionize pilot training.

The partnership marks Loft Dynamics' entry into the fixed-wing market, bringing their FAA- and EASA-qualified VR technology to commercial airline training. The new simulators will feature a six-degrees-of-freedom motion platform, 360-degree panoramic 3D view, advanced full-body tracking, and customizable training scenarios, all while requiring just 1/12th the space of traditional simulators.

Once developed and approved by the FAA in the coming years, these VR simulators will be installed at Alaska Airlines bases, potentially reducing training travel time and costs while maintaining high training standards. In the meantime, Alaska and Loft plan to explore supplementary training opportunities alongside existing FAA-required programs.

Alaska Airlines (ALK) has announced new nonstop service between Seattle and Seoul Incheon starting September 12, 2025, operated by Hawaiian Airlines using Airbus A330-200 aircraft. The route launch coincides with Chuseok (Korean Thanksgiving) celebrations in early October.

The expansion is part of Alaska's strategy to transform Seattle into the West Coast's premier global gateway. The airline plans to serve at least 12 nonstop international destinations with widebody aircraft from Seattle by 2030, including the recently announced Tokyo Narita route beginning May 12.

Alaska's Seattle hub, the largest airline hub on the West Coast, currently serves 104 nonstop destinations across North America. The airline plans to eventually operate the Seattle-Seoul route with its Boeing 787 Dreamliner aircraft.

Alaska Airlines (ALK) has appointed Eric Edge as Vice President of Brand & Marketing for both Alaska Airlines and Hawaiian Airlines brands. Edge will oversee the marketing strategy for the combined airline's operations, focusing on delivering remarkable travel experiences while maintaining distinct brand identities.

Key initiatives for 2025 include launching new global routes from Seattle to Tokyo Narita (NRT) and Seoul Incheon (ICN), implementing a unified loyalty program, and introducing a premium credit card for global travelers. Edge, who joined Alaska Airlines in 2022 as managing director of marketing and advertising, has already contributed to increasing brand perception and achieving double-digit revenue growth in key markets.

The appointment supports Alaska Airlines' ongoing integration with Hawaiian Airlines, creating a dual-brand model with combined operations while preserving each airline's unique identity.

Alaska Airlines (ALK) and Hawaiian Airlines are partnering with TDW+Co to create a one-day immersive branded house experience at Austin's Inn Cahoots during SXSW festival on March 5, 2025. The event aims to showcase innovative travel technology and connect with next-gen travelers.

The interactive hub will feature demonstrations of cutting-edge airline industry advancements, including electronic bag tags powered by BAGTAG and BagsID's AI-powered baggage recognition technology. Visitors can participate in a 'Vibe Quiz' for personalized travel recommendations and explore the 'Future Gate Vision' highlighting airport experience improvements.

The event runs from 1 p.m. to 7 p.m. CST, requiring pre-registration. This collaboration comes as Hawaiian Airlines prepares to join the oneworld Alliance in 2026, where Alaska Airlines is already a member, serving over 140 destinations across North America, Latin America, Asia and the Pacific.

Alaska Airlines (NYSE: ALK) announced that over 6,900 flight attendants, represented by the Association of Flight Attendants (AFA), have ratified a new three-year contract with a 95% approval rate and 90% voter participation. The agreement, effective March 2, 2025, includes significant improvements such as increased pay with boarding pay, market rate adjustments, and a ratification payment.

The contract maintains the industry's shortest duty day at 10 hours and 30 minutes, alongside Southwest, and features enhanced work rules, scheduling flexibility, and benefits including caps on insurance premiums. This marks the eighth ratified labor contract between Alaska Air Group and its represented workgroups in the last three years, supporting the company's vision of creating remarkable travel experiences.

Alaska Air Group (NYSE: ALK) reported strong financial results for Q4 and full year 2024, achieving record revenue of $11.7 billion. The company delivered a GAAP pretax margin of 4.6% and an adjusted pretax margin of 7.1%, expected to be among the industry's best despite challenges including the Hawaiian Airlines acquisition and fleet grounding in Q1.

The company completed its acquisition of Hawaiian Airlines on September 18, 2024, and aims to generate $1 billion in incremental pretax profit over the next three years through this strategic combination. Additionally, ALK repurchased approximately $250 million in outstanding shares during Q4 and announced performance-based pay equivalent to six weeks' salary for most Alaska and Horizon employees.

Alaska Airlines (ALK) has announced three new year-round nonstop routes starting May 15, 2025: a daily flight between Portland and Houston's George Bush Intercontinental Airport, twice-daily service between Portland and Eugene, and a new route between San Diego and Medford, Oregon.

The Portland-Houston route marks Alaska's first connection between these cities, with Portland flights departing at 10:30 a.m. and Houston departures just before 6 p.m. The airline is also increasing service frequency on existing Oregon routes, with Portland-Medford increasing to four daily flights and Portland-Redmond operating year-round with three daily flights.

Portland serves as one of Alaska's key West Coast hubs, currently offering more than 100 daily departures to 58 nonstop destinations, including four international routes. The airline remains the largest carrier in Portland for over 20 years.

Alaska Airlines (ALK) has announced new seasonal nonstop flights connecting Anchorage to both Detroit and Sacramento starting June 14, 2025, expanding its summer service to 15 nonstop destinations from Anchorage to the Lower 48 and Hawaii. The airline will also resume daily nonstop service between Fairbanks and Portland beginning May 15, 2025.

The weekly roundtrip flights to Detroit and Sacramento will operate until August 16, 2025, using Boeing 737 aircraft. The Fairbanks-Portland route, operating until August 19, will use E175 aircraft. Additionally, Alaska Airlines is launching several new seasonal routes this week, including services from Sacramento to Los Cabos, Puerto Vallarta, Orlando, and Tucson, as well as connections between Boise-Orlando and New York JFK-Puerto Vallarta.

Alaska Airlines has appointed John Wiitala as the new vice president of maintenance and engineering. Wiitala brings over 34 years of airline experience, most recently serving as vice president and chief engineer of tech operations, safety, and compliance at United Airlines.

Wiitala will oversee the maintenance of Alaska's fleet of 237 Boeing aircraft, focusing on safety and compliance. His responsibilities include line maintenance operations, airframe and engine maintenance, quality assurance, and fleet projects.

At United, Wiitala expanded operations from under 450 to 944 aircraft and played a key role in the United-Continental merger. Alaska Airlines' executive vice president Constance von Muehlen praised Wiitala's expertise and leadership as the airline aims to become a global carrier.
